Transaction 3df2cfc2089a92fb2bdf41c499eb0e25e138133b1cc81a444f6477cd3533c1a6

2 Input
2 Outputs
  • 3df2cfc2089a92fb2bdf41c499eb0e25e138133b1cc81a444f6477cd3533c1a6:0
  • value  590406
    address  3BSAhaZhzdmu7yQbHpLMmsFTjzD5wiHqaZ
  • 3df2cfc2089a92fb2bdf41c499eb0e25e138133b1cc81a444f6477cd3533c1a6:1
  • value  18611570
    address  17pUbjFNq9H1VyVBJtRT51pkhaU7FkuVMD